Output 3ec27c5b0ebf397d8ee65ea7147122dab07b61f813d10dc42052b35510f90d89:1

value
16500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b1b027db8039f1eb19c5138fc3b52384c310de OP_EQUAL
address
3LzMN1K18PRAv9pfNR8u4Lj632XAFSMqic
transaction
3ec27c5b0ebf397d8ee65ea7147122dab07b61f813d10dc42052b35510f90d89
confirmations
482923
spent
true